We welcome back David Leninhawk for a discussion of Roman Polanski's classic neo-noir, Chinatown. Starring Jack Nicholson, Faye Dunaway, and John Huston, this story of murder and corruption and in 1930's Los Angeles won the Oscar for Best Screenplay.
